Jogging in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al offers a variety of running routes through a landscape shaped by the Eyach river and its surrounding valleys. The region features a mix of forested areas, riverbanks, and some open terrain, providing diverse settings for runners. Elevation changes are present, with routes ranging from relatively flat paths along the water to more undulating trails through the hills. This area is suitable for those seeking both leisurely runs and more challenging workouts.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al?

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al offers a wide selection of over 600 running routes. These range from easy, leisurely jogs to more challenging trails, catering to all fitness levels.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ly running routes in the region?

Yes, there are approximately 63 easy running routes in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al, perfect for beginners or those looking for a relaxed jog. Many of these follow the riverbanks, offering relatively flat terrain.

What are the options for more challenging or difficult running trails?

For experienced runners seeking a challenge,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al features around 136 difficult routes. An example is the Andreas Zordel Trout Farm – Eyachmühle Inn loop from Neuenbürg (Württ.) Eyachbrücke, which covers over 21 km with significant elevation changes.

Can I find circular running routes in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al?

Many of the running routes in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For instance, the Eyachmühle Inn – Wildsee raised bog loop from Eyachmühle is a challenging circular route of nearly 24 km.

What kind of natural sights or attractions can I expect along the running trails?

The region is rich in natural beauty. Along your runs, you might encounter features like the Sprudelbach Spring, the scenic Carl-Postweiler-Way along the river, or the tranquil Eyachtal Stream. The Eyach Water Trail itself is a highlight.

Are there any places to eat or have a coffee near the running routes?

Yes, you can find options like the Eyachmühle Inn, which is often a starting or ending point for several routes, offering refreshments. There are also picnic areas such as the Lehmannshof Picnic Area for a break.

What do other runners say about the trails in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al?

The running trails in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.4 stars from over 650 reviews. Runners frequently praise the diverse landscape, well-maintained paths, and the peaceful atmosphere along the Eyach river.

Is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al suitable for family-friendly jogging or walks?

Yes, many of the easier and moderate routes along the river are suitable for families. The varied terrain and natural attractions provide an engaging environment for both jogging and leisurely walks with children.

Are dogs allowed on the running trails in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al?

Generally, dogs are welcome on most trails in the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al region, especially in natural areas. However, it's always advisable to keep them on a leash, particularly in forested areas or near wildlife, and to check for any specific local regulations.

What is the best season for running in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al?

Spring and autumn are particularly pleasant for running in Eyach-Und Rotenbachtal, with mild temperatures and beautiful scenery as the foliage changes. Summer offers longer daylight hours, while winter can provide a unique experience with snow-covered landscapes, though some paths might be slippery.

Are there public transport options to access the running trails?

The region has some public transport connections, particularly to towns like Neuenbürg (Württ.) Eyachbrücke, which serve as starting points for several routes. It's recommended to check local bus or train schedules for specific access points to the trails.

Where can I find parking for the running routes?

Parking is generally available at common starting points for routes, such as near the Eyachmühle or in Neuenbürg (Württ.) Eyachbrücke. Look for designated parking areas or roadside spots where permitted.
